EDITORS COMMENTS
In this photograph, titled "Going to the Spring" we are transported back in time to witness a scene of everyday life in the 19th century. The image captures a water carrier making their way towards a natural spring, with two large buckets hanging from either end of a long wooden pole balanced effortlessly on their shoulder. The composition is beautifully framed, allowing us to appreciate the intricate details of both the subject and the surrounding landscape. The water carrier's worn-out clothes and weathered face tell tales of hard work and resilience, while their determined stride suggests an unwavering commitment to fulfilling their duty. As our gaze extends beyond the central figure, we are greeted by lush greenery that surrounds them. Tall trees stand tall against an open sky, casting dappled shadows on the path ahead. There is a sense of tranquility in this serene setting - nature serving as both provider and sanctuary. This print by Paul Falconer Poole evokes feelings of nostalgia and admiration for those who labored tirelessly behind-the-scenes during simpler times. It serves as a poignant reminder that even mundane tasks can hold great significance within society. Displayed proudly at Bury Art Museum & Sculpture Centre in the UK, this artwork invites us to reflect upon our own relationship with water - its abundance or scarcity - and how it connects us all through shared human experiences across generations.
